Output 3359858845479aa2af6dc952a7539734de625d07475397923868523e47c64563:0

value
1852195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e0883b18d0e3fa81586c4fdf2015c3beee88e4 OP_EQUAL
address
3H5xRYCLARBS125LuFGYfU6XVw5WVvC54K
transaction
3359858845479aa2af6dc952a7539734de625d07475397923868523e47c64563
spent
true